Ingredients You’ll Need

  • 1 cup rolled oats
  • 1 cup of milk (or plant milk of choice)
  • 1 egg
  • 1 cup oat fl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on apple cider vinegar
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• 2 tablespoons of apple sauce
  • 1 cup of sugar (or coconut sugar)
  • 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ract
  • Dark semi-sweet chocolate chips

How to Make Them

  1. Preheat & Prep – Set your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a muffin tin with liners.
  2. Mix the Ingredients – In a large bowl, whisk together the oats and milk and let sit for about 10 minutes. Then add the remaining ingredients (except the chocolate chips) and mix well together.
  3. Fill & Sprinkle– Divide the batter evenly among the muffin cups, filling each about ¾ full. Next, sprinkle the chocolate chips on top of each muffin.
  4. Bake – Bake for 18–22 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  5. Cool & Enjoy – Let the muffins rest in the tin for 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ely. Note: The wrappers are easier to remove the next day (if you can wait that long!).

Pro Tips for Perfect Muffins

  • Don’t overmix – Overmixing can lead to dense muffins. Stir just until the ingredients are incorporated.
  • Make them your own – Swap chocolate chips for chopped nuts, dried fruit, or a sprinkle of coconut flakes.
  • Store smartly – Keep these muffins fresh by storing them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days or refrigerating for up to a week. They also freeze beautifully for up to three months!
